The Regional Sales Director is directly responsible for maintaining existing and developing new client relationships within an assigned territory in support of achievement of order intake and profitability objectives. This includes the development of sales strategies to maximize top line growth and profitability within the organization’s Transport Automation offerings focused on Modernization, small Construction and Preventative Maintenance Agreement sales.

Director Region Sales is directly responsible for selling:
• Small Construction Projects typically with a sell price of $150,000 or less
• Modernization
• New Systems up to 4 stations in size
• Service Support Agreements (includes PMA and SMA)

Director Region Sales is responsible for supporting Senior Director Region Sales of:
• Design Assist projects (does not include early coordination only)
• Strategic named accounts
• Customers at risk of loss to competition
• Projects focused strictly on System Performance Enhancements
• Competitive conversions

Base salary range for this position is $80,000 - $95,000, plus sales incentive plan, plus car allowance - $170,000+ OTE. Salary will be commensurate with experience and skillset. We offer a comprehensive benefits package including medical / dental / vision insurance, tuition reimbursement, disability, 401k matching (up to 8%).
